  • Overview

    The Palmway Gardens off Lake Ave opportunity is wonderfully located just a short bike ride or walk to one of the most pristine beaches South Florida has to offer. Downtown West Palm Beach is just minutes up Federal Highway to the North and Downtown Delray similarly distanced to the south. Interstate 95 is connected by both 6th Avenue South and 10th Avenue North. Lake Worth Beach is widely considered the next domino in the constantly “under construction” South Florida market. There are extensive development plans currently in process including the repositioning of the Gulf Stream Hotel which is part of the U.S. National Register of Historic Places. Born in 1923, the Gulf Stream Hotel will be strategically repositioned and provide a tourism boom to the overall downtown and beach areas of Lake Worth Beach. Overlooking the intracoastal and city parks that include the bandshell at Bryant Park, Gulf Stream Hotel will support tourism and jobs related to many local festivals including but not limited to the annual Reggae Fest, Street Painting Festival, Finlandia Week, Lake Worth Festival of Trees, Gay Pride Parade and bi-weekly Evenings on the Avenue at Cultural Plaza. Locally renowned, the city is home to some of the best water activities in the state, Lake Worth Beach affectionately bills itself “Where the Tropics Begin”. Some of South Florida’s best examples of the Art Deco era is alive and well in Lake Worth Beach with the city going to great lengths to preserve that rich history. Lake Worth Historical Museum and the Art Deco Lake Worth Playhouse are in the Downtown Area and provides for a continued focus on the local arts scene. Lake Worth Beach provides an exceptional small-town vibe complete with a charming downtown that is highly walkable and bordered by Lake and Lucerne Avenue. Very centrally located to large corporate employers that include Florida Crystals Corporation, Pratt & Whitney, U.S. Sugar, Johnson Controls, Lockheed Martin, Sikorsky, IBM, and more. It is estimated that 38,526 people call Lake Worth Beach home. The area service economy also benefits greatly from being minutes away from some of the highest priced exclusive real estate with Palm Beach and Manalapan leading the way. Palmway Gardens off Lake Ave features significant upside in value creation through market rent stabilization. Located in the very desirable submarket of Lake Worth Beach, all eyes are on this bohemian and quaint downtown as it continues to grow up and look to the future. Widely recognized as a city of progress due to a recent rebranding alongside an aggressive CRA looking to build on a local history that goes back to the incorporated year of 1913 and earlier. Mixed Use and Redevelopment Projects including The Mid, The One Luxury Condominiums (1 S Palmway), West Village Art Lofts, and Lake Worth Beach Casino & Complex. Palmway Gardens off Lake Ave has been almost entirely renovated with new flooring and new kitchens that feature granite counters, tile backsplash, wood kitchens, hurricane impact windows, exterior painting, lush landscaping. The property features on-site laundry service, rented parking spaces and extensive lighted street parking options. Location has warranted a remarkably high occupancy rate historically and is in constant demand due to proximity to world class area amenities and major economic drivers. The subject property is almost entirely repositioned in 2020 with the owners going to great length to preserve the character of the asset and accentuate its proximity to everything Lake Worth Beach has to offer. Palmway Gardens off Lake Ave is in the CRA and path of progress. Current zoning is MF-30 (Medium-Density Multiple-Family Residential District). The MF-30 medium-density multiple-family residential district implements the “high-density multiple-family residential” land use category of the Lake Worth Beach Comprehensive Plan.
